I have my lovely light MB210 and after advice here I have ordered the 210MBE extension this morning

I will obviously need a Speakon cable to connect them, but unfortunately I have zero experience of these.

From googling I see that there are 2 pole and 4 pole versions of these and for most uses the 4 pole seems to be recommended but I can't find anywhere that tells me whether a 4 pole will work with this set up or whether I should get a basic 2 pole.

(I understand that there will be no advantage in this situation of a 4 pole but it may give me more flexibility if I change my rig later)

Standard 2-pole speakon will do it. Regarding their manual, the speaker output is wired +1 and -1, no need to use a 4-pole cable (but it might be useful in the future, as you said).

Gauge is important as well. Remember that a lower number means a thicker cable that can carry a load a longer distance. Mine are typically 16 gauge.

Agreed, but you you want genuine Neutrik Speakon connectors on it. The Chinese knockoffs are often sub-standard, I have had trouble with them, and have heard of jacks damaged by them.
